Which Grains to Freeze. Any whole grain can be cooked and frozen: white or brown rice, barley, farro, wheat berries, rye berries, or buckwheat. Even smaller grains like quinoa or millet do well.
Do cooked grains freeze well?
If you are good about using your grains and beans throughout the week, airtight containers in the fridge work fine. Cooked grains and beans will last approximately 3-4 days in the fridge. They’ll last about 2 months in the freezer.
Can I freeze cooked quinoa?
Frozen cooked quinoa will last for up to 6 months in the freezer. Be sure to store it in tightly sealed containers or bags, with as much air as possible squeezed out, for best results and to prevent freezer burn.
How do you preserve cooked grains?
How to Freeze Grains
- Step 1: Cool the cooked grains completely on a tray or sheet pan. You want them to dry properly so the extra moisture doesn’t cause them to clump.
- Step 2: Portion cooked grains into reusable, eco-friendly containers.
- Step 3: Label containers and jars with the date and ingredient – and freeze!

Can you freeze cooked lentils and chickpeas?
You can cook batches of lentils, peas or chickpeas and freeze them in single-serving or meal-size portions. Pulses that are firmer after being cooked will freeze better than those cooked to a soft texture. Be sure to remove as much moisture as possible before freezing by patting cooked pulses with a dry paper towel.
Can you freeze chickpeas and lentils?
Yes, lentils do freeze well. However, they expand in the freezer. It’s a good idea to leave a little space of about two inches in the container or bag you are freezing them in.

How do you reheat frozen cooked rice?
How to Reheat Frozen Rice. Place frozen rice in a baking pan. Sprinkle lightly with water (no more than ½ tablespoon per cup of rice). Cover with tinfoil and bake at 300°F for 30-40 minutes or, if you have allowed it to partially thaw, at 300°F for 20-30 minutes.
How do you defrost frozen cooked rice?
Transfer the grains to a microwave-safe bowl or a small saucepan and sprinkle a tablespoon or two of water over top. Cover the bowl or pan, then microwave in 1-minute bursts until warmed through, or place the saucepan over low heat until warmed.

Can I eat defrosted rice cold?
Risks of eating cold rice
Eating cold or reheated rice increases your risk of food poisoning from Bacillus cereus, which may cause abdominal cramps, diarrhea, or vomiting within 15–30 minutes of ingesting it ( 9 , 10, 11 , 12). Bacillus cereus is a bacterium typically found in soil that can contaminate raw rice.

Can I freeze hard-boiled eggs?
HARD-BOILED EGGS
Remove the pan from the heat and let the yolks stand, covered, in the hot water about 12 minutes. Remove the yolks with a slotted spoon, drain them well and package them for freezing. It’s best not to freeze hard-boiled whole eggs and hard-boiled whites because they become tough and watery when frozen.
